Sat 753951441023916

decimal
150790.1441023916
degree
0°150790′1606″1441023916‴
percentile
35.90244961206014%
name
imwsqvqtbrx
cycle
0
epoch
0
period
74
block
150790
offset
1441023916
timestamp
rarity
common